链轮端面圆弧的编程可以通过以下步骤进行:
确定圆弧的起点、终点和圆心坐标
起点:圆弧加工的起始位置。
终点:圆弧加工的结束位置。
圆心:圆弧的圆心位置,通常选择在起点和终点的连线上延长线上的某个点。
计算圆心相对于起点和终点的相对坐标
计算圆心相对于起点的X和Y坐标差值,分别记为I和J。
选择合适的G代码
根据圆弧的方向选择G02(逆时针圆弧插补)或G03(顺时针圆弧插补)。
编写数控程序
使用G02或G03指令,填入起点、终点和圆心坐标以及进给速度F。
示例代码:
```
G02 X终点Y终点 I圆心X坐标 J圆心Y坐标 F进给速度
```
例如:
```
G02 X10 Y20 I5 J10 F100
```
考虑其他辅助功能
使用G94设置进给速度。
使用G97设置转速。
使用M代码控制冷却液、夹具等辅助功能。
调试和加工
将编写好的数控程序上传到数控机床进行调试和加工。
注意事项:
圆心的选择要合理,确保圆弧位置与工件形状匹配,避免夹角不合适或交叉。
进给速度要适中,过快或过慢都可能影响加工质量。
在编程过程中,确保所有坐标系和参数设置正确无误。
通过以上步骤和注意事项,可以实现链轮端面圆弧的精确编程和加工。